
About Anthony Red Rose
b. Anthony Cameron, c.1962, Kingston, Jamaica, West Indies. At the start of his career, Michael Rose recorded as Tony Rose, which led to Anthony performing as Red Rose to avoid confusion. Anthony Red Rose has the distinction of recording the first hit from King Tubby's new studio in 1985. The song "Tempo" was recorded in the Waterhouse style initially popularized by Tenor Saw, and the latter's popular song "Fever" was almost identical to the Red Rose hit.
